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don't have a pocket knife lurking in one of the compartments of your carry-on luggage. Other banned items include flammable or explosive products, such as aerosol cans and fuel, and liquids and gels in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your main priority when choosing what to wear on your flight. Loose clothing is a smart choice, as are enclosed shoes like sneakers.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Walk around the cabin and give your legs a stretch or do some gentle exercises in your seat to impro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Bana?
Being organized before you get to the airport will help make your getaway to Bana quick and painless. We've rounded up some top tips for a swift journey through security:

  • Your travel ID and boarding pass will need to be inspected by security personnel. Keep them at hand so you don't hold up the queue.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your belt, coat, keys and other contents of your pockets,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them before your turn.
  • For just a few moments, you'll have to unplug from technology. Your phone, tablet and any other electronics will also need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Remove gels and liquids from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• There's a good chance you'll be required to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a smart idea.
  • Airlines won't allow any pocket knives or other sharp items to come on board with you. If you must b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ked baggage.
